什么是区块链

            区块链是一种分布式账本技术,它是由多个节点共同维护的一个公开的、可验证的数据库。区块链通过加密技术和共识算法,实现了去中心化、不可篡改、可追溯的特性,能够实现各种价值的跨组织、跨边界的安全交换和传递。

            什么是Rev模型

            Rev模型是区块链中常用的一种共识算法。Rev全称为Reputation-based Economic Voting。在Rev模型中,每个参与者都有一个声誉值,通过评估和投票确定参与者的声誉值高低。声誉值高的参与者在共识达成过程中具有更大的投票权重,从而影响系统的状态以及新区块的产生。

            区块链的Rev模型原理

            Rev模型的核心原理是基于声誉评估和投票的共识机制。具体来说,Rev模型通过以下几个步骤来确定参与者的声誉值:

            1. 声誉评估:参与者的声誉值通过一定的评估机制进行计算。评估机制可以根据参与者的贡献度、历史行为等因素来进行评估。
            2. 投票机制:在共识过程中,参与者根据自身的声誉值进行投票。声誉值高的参与者拥有更大的投票权重。
            3. 共识达成:通过投票的方式,参与者共同决定系统的状态和新区块的产生。具体的共识算法可以根据实际需求进行选择,如PoW(工作量证明)、PoS(权益证明)等。

            Rev模型的优势

            Rev模型在区块链中具有以下优势:

            • 公平性:通过评估和投票机制,更加公平地决定参与者的声誉值和投票权重,避免了某些节点的垄断。
            • 安全性:声誉值高的参与者具有更大的投票权重,提高了系统的安全性,降低了恶意攻击的可能性。
            • 可扩展性:Rev模型可以根据实际需求进行扩展和调整,适用于各种不同规模和复杂度的区块链应用场景。

            Rev模型的应用领域

            Rev模型可以在各个领域的区块链应用中发挥作用,特别适用于以下场景:

            • 供应链管理:通过Rev模型评估供应链参与者的声誉值,实现供应链的透明度和可信度。
            • 物联网网络:在物联网网络中使用Rev模型,可以评估设备的信任度,防止未经授权的设备对网络进行攻击。
            • 社交网络:Rev模型可以用于社交网络中用户的信任度评估,提高社交网络的安全性和可信度。
            总结:

            Rev模型是区块链中常用的一种共识算法,通过声誉评估和投票机制确定参与者的声誉值和投票权重,实现公平、安全、可扩展的共识机制。Rev模型在供应链管理、物联网网络、社交网络等领域都有广泛的应用潜力。